Biotechnology encompasses a vast array of disciplines, from genetic engineering to
pharmaceutical development. It is characterized by innovative breakthroughs such as
CRISPR-Cas9 gene editing and the production of biopharmaceuticals. Biotechnology serves
as a bridge between science and medicine, embodying the potential to address diseases at
their genetic roots.
At the heart of this medical renaissance is genomic medicine, a field that leverage s our
understanding of the human genome to tailor healthcare solutions to individuals. By
analyzing an individual's genetic makeup, healthcare providers can offer personalized
treatment plans and preventive measures. Genomic medicine embodies the concept of
"precision medicine," where interventions are precisely calibrated to maximize efficacy.
